Understanding the Major Players

In the vacation rental landscape, several major players dominate the market, each offering unique features and experiences. Key platforms include Airbnb, Vrbo, Booking.com, and HomeAway, each catering to different segments of travelers and hosts.

Airbnb is often recognized for its wide array of listings, ranging from shared rooms to luxury accommodations. Vrbo primarily targets families and groups, focusing on entire homes, making it a favored choice for larger gatherings. Booking.com is known for integrating vacation rentals into its extensive hotel offerings, appealing to travelers seeking more traditional lodging alongside unique experiences.

HomeAway, which is now part of Vrbo, served as a pioneering platform for vacation rentals and continues to promote family-friendly properties. These platforms provide distinct advantages depending on the target audience and property type, thus influencing the vacation rental platforms comparison. Understanding these players is vital for hosts and travelers aiming to find the best match for their needs.

Geographic Reach of Vacation Rental Platforms

The geographic reach of vacation rental platforms greatly influences their utility for hosts and travelers alike. These platforms vary significantly in their presence, with some focusing on specific regions while others maintain a global footprint. Understanding this reach is vital for evaluating user options and optimizing rental profitability.

For instance, Airbnb boasts an extensive global presence, offering accommodations in more than 220 countries. In contrast, regional platforms like Vrbo primarily serve North American and European markets, showcasing homes suitable for families seeking vacation rentals. This distinction illustrates how geographic reach affects the audience each platform attracts.

Moreover, local regulations and market conditions can shape the availability of properties on these platforms. Areas with high tourist demand may see diverse listings, while regions with stricter short-term rental laws may limit options. Thus, a thorough vacation rental platforms comparison necessitates examining geographic reach to maximize booking opportunities and align with target markets.

Comparing Safety and Security Features

Safety and security features are pivotal elements of vacation rental platforms, reflecting their commitment to protect hosts and guests. These features encompass various measures, including user verification processes, secure payment gateways, and insurance offerings.

User verification helps establish trust; platforms often require government-issued IDs or other identifying documents from both hosts and guests. Secure payment systems safeguard financial transactions, ensuring that sensitive information remains confidential and protected from unauthorized access.

Insurance is another critical aspect, as many platforms offer host protection policies to cover potential damages or liabilities. Additionally, guest reviews and ratings provide insight into previous experiences, which can aid in decision-making about the safety and reliability of a rental.

When conducting a vacation rental platforms comparison, evaluating the effectiveness of these safety and security features is essential for ensuring a safe and enjoyable experience for all parties involved.

Monetization Strategies for Hosts on Various Platforms

Hosts on vacation rental platforms have several monetization strategies at their disposal. These strategies allow property owners to maximize their earnings while catering to different market demands. Among the most effective tactics are dynamic pricing, long-term rentals, and seasonal promotions.

Dynamic pricing involves adjusting rental rates based on current demand, local events, and seasons. For instance, platforms like Airbnb and VRBO offer tools that enable hosts to set competitive rates automatically, increasing revenue during peak travel periods. This approach helps optimize occupancy rates while catering to varying guest needs.

Long-term rentals present another avenue for hosts seeking consistent income. By offering their property for extended stays, hosts can tap into a steady stream of renters, which can be particularly beneficial in markets with a high demand for temporary housing. Platforms such as Furnished Finder are designed specifically to connect hosts with long-term travelers.

Seasonal promotions enable hosts to attract guests during off-peak periods. By offering discounts or special packages, property owners can fill vacancies that might otherwise remain unoccupied. This strategy not only increases income but also enhances visibility on rental platforms, creating a win-win situation for hosts.
